Felix Gray Review: What to Know Before You Buy

Felix Gray is an eyewear company that designs and sells glasses with blue light filtering technology. The goal is to protect eyes from digital screens. 

Felix Gray’s glasses are designed for people who spend a lot of time in front of screens, such as computers, smartphones, tablets, and other electronic devices. 

What Does Felix Gray Offer?

Felix Gray sells their eyewear products to consumers via their website and retail stores. This direct-to-consumer model reduces costs, allowing them to offer products at a more affordable price point. Felix Gray also offers a subscription service, fostering a loyal customer base. 

The company also sells an “ocular support supplement” they call InSight. This product is based on the AREDS2 formula.

The company’s customer service is focused on providing a positive experience for customers. Because of this, they offer free shipping, free returns, and a 30-day risk-free trial on all products.

Costs 

Felix Gray sells daily contacts for $40 for a 30-day supply, and the first month’s supply costs a sharply reduced $5. Their frames were generally priced similarly to other retailers. A pair of frames usually costs about $100 and frames with prescription lenses cost around $145 for single vision lenses or $290 for progressive lenses. Felix Gray’s lenses are blue light filtering.

The company also sells online vision testing for $25, and the test gives you a 10% discount on your next prescription glasses order. This is an FDA-cleared online vision test, meaning it should be able to get most users a valid glasses prescription if conducted correctly.

Insurance Coverage

As an eyewear company, Felix Gray typically operates as an out-of-network provider for insurance purposes. This means that they do not have direct agreements with insurance companies to provide coverage for their products. However, many insurance providers offer reimbursement for out-of-network purchases. Customers may be able to submit a claim to their insurance provider for a portion of the cost of their Felix Gray eyewear.

The reimbursement process varies depending on the insurance provider and the specific plan a customer has. In general, customers will need to pay for their Felix Gray eyewear upfront and then submit a claim to their insurance provider for reimbursement. The insurance company may require a copy of the receipt, proof of purchase, and a statement from a qualified eye doctor verifying the medical necessity of the eyewear.

Shipping Information

Standard shipping is generally free from Felix Gray, with free shipping available for all orders over $20. The company also offers UPS 3-day shipping for $15 and UPS Next Day Air for $30.

Expedited shipping isn’t refundable, which is normal for most online retailers.

How do Felix Gray glasses work?

According to the company, Felix Gray lenses work through proprietary blue light filtering and anti-glare technology. Their lenses are designed to filter 50% of all blue light, with the company claiming their lenses block almost 90% of the most impactful range of blue light that is most likely to trigger negative or uncomfortable effects.
